ShortCutz Amsterdam Annual Awards 2015
Featurette of the ShortCutz Amsterdam Annual Awards ceremony, 2015.
Several guests stepped in to inspire and award the new generation of Dutch Cinema: Tom Six (The Human Centipede), Hany Abu-Assad (Paradise Now), Pierre Bokma (The Assault), Hisko Hulsing (Cobain: Montage of Heck), Heddy Honigmann (El Olvido), Remy van Heugten (Gluckauf), Claire Pijman (Buena Vista Social Club), Nanouk Leopold (Guernsey), Lucia Rijker (Million Dollar Baby), EYE's CEO Sandra den Hamer, Maartje Seyferth and Victor Nieuwenhuijs (Vlees).
Rutger Hauer received Shortcutz Career Award for his dedication and contribution to cinema at home and abroad and for being a role-model for the new generation. Hauer received the award with a standing ovation following an introduction by Maarten Treurniet.
Shortcutz Amsterdam jury was composed of actor Tygo Gernandt, director Roel Reiné, actor Vincent van Ommen, actress Ariane Schluter, director Eddy Terstall, producer Jeroen Koolbergen, producer Jan Doense, producer Harmen Jalvingh, Nederlands Film Festival programmer Claire van Daal, EYE head of programme René Wolf, and street-artist Laser 3.14.
